How they compare
Peru currently reports 95.64 against 95.15 in Cuba, a difference of 0.49.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Cuba ahead.
Cuba ranks 27th and Peru ranks 24th of 35 countries.
Cuba has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cuba | Peru |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 92.39 | 83.68 | 8.71 | Cuba |
| 2010s | 93.62 | 90.1 | 3.52 | Cuba |
| 2020s | 94.83 | 94.5 | 0.3335 | Cuba |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
